Why Brake Maintenance Is Critical

Prioritize Your Safety

Your brakes are one of the most important safety systems in your vehicle. Routine brake service ensures that they’re functioning as they should, giving you the stopping power necessary to avoid potential hazards on the road.

Prevent Costly Repairs

Preventative maintenance is key to avoiding expensive repairs down the line. At Tasca Buick GMC Melbourne, we thoroughly inspect your brake pads, rotors, and fluid levels to identify and fix minor issues before they escalate into major problems.

Save Money Over Time

Addressing small brake issues early—such as worn brake pads—prevents more severe damage to other parts like rotors, helping you avoid costly repairs that could have been easily prevented.

Enhance Your Vehicle’s Performance

Properly maintained brakes contribute to your vehicle’s overall performance. You’ll benefit from better control during sudden stops and enjoy shorter stopping distances, keeping you safer on the road.

Consequences of Skipping Brake Service

Compromised Braking Ability

Worn brake pads and insufficient brake fluid can diminish your vehicle’s ability to stop effectively, increasing the chances of accidents, especially during emergency situations.

Unexpected Brake Failure

If left unchecked, brake issues can lead to sudden failure, especially when you’re driving in stressful or high-pressure environments. This poses a significant risk to both you and other drivers.

Higher Repair Bills

Ignoring regular brake maintenance can lead to bigger issues like damaged rotors or faulty calipers, which are more expensive to fix than simple pad replacements or fluid top-ups.

Damage to Other Systems

Failing to maintain your brakes properly can also cause wear and tear on other vehicle components such as tires and suspension, which can lead to additional repair costs.

When to Schedule Brake Service

Annual Inspections

To maintain optimal brake performance, it’s a good idea to have your brakes inspected every 12 months or every 12,000 miles. Regular inspections help spot issues early, ensuring your vehicle is always in safe driving condition.

Replace Brake Pads on Time

Brake pads typically need replacement every 25,000 to 50,000 miles. If you hear a high-pitched squeal or grinding noise, it’s likely time for new pads.

Changing Brake Fluid

Your brake fluid should be changed every 2 to 3 years, or as recommended by your vehicle manufacturer. Over time, old brake fluid absorbs moisture, which can lead to decreased braking power and corrosion of brake parts.

Look for Warning Signs

If you notice any signs of brake trouble—such as a spongy brake pedal, vibrations when you brake, or a brake warning light on your dashboard—it’s critical to have your brakes checked right away.
